QUINTERO v. SINCLAIR REFINING COMPANY

No. 19849.

311 F.2d 217 (1962)

Julian QUINTERO, Appellant, v. SINCLAIR REFINING COMPANY, Appellee.

United States Court of Appeals Fifth Circuit.

December 11, 1962.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

W. Jiles Roberts, Houston, Tex., for appellant.

Don F. McNiel, Houston, Tex., Baker, Botts, Shepherd & Coates, Houston, Tex., of counsel, for appellee.

Before HUTCHESON, CAMERON and JONES, Circuit Judges.


CAMERON, Circuit Judge.

This is an appeal from a jury verdict and judgment against appellant, a seaman, who claims damages as a result of an injury sustained while working aboard appellee's vessel. The action was based on unseaworthiness and negligence under the Jones Act, 46 U.S.C.A. § 688, and the case was submitted to the jury on special interrogatories.
